Abstract

The invention provides a 430 nm LED aesthetic lamp and an intelligent control method thereof. The 430 nm LED aesthetic lamp is provided with a 430 nm LED lighting chip; the 430 nm LED lighting chip is connected with a driving circuit comprising a power module; the driving circuit is connected with an MCU (microprogrammed control unit) module; working mode control software of the 430 nm LED lighting chip is placed in the MCU module; the MCU module is connected with an intelligent mobile terminal in a communication mode through a wireless module; and the intelligent mobile terminal is used for setting a working mode of the 430 nm LED aesthetic lamp. Control parameters are transmitted to the MCU module through an aesthetic sterilizing mode control APP (application) installed on the intelligent mobile terminal, so that starting and closing time and lighting power of the 430 nm LED lighting chip are controlled, and the 430 nm LED lighting chip works in the set aesthetic sterilizing mode; and working time and lighting intensity of the 430 nm LED lamp can also be recorded so as to prevent influences on human bodies due to super-power and super-long-time sterilization. In addition, the lighting frequency of the 430 nm LED lighting chip is 430 nm so that an aesthetic effect on acne sterilization is achieved.
